To ice or not to ice, that is the question. The latest answer seems to be not to ice.
"The exception to this rule would be when injuries are severe and in circumstances where swelling will likely be the limiting factor for recovery. In these cases, ice may be beneficial in the early stages only."

SIJ pain or dysfunction may result in lower back pain. It's important to address the cause of SIJ pain correctly. We can help.

Sacroiliac joint dysfunction may arise with no cause or result from trauma. Common symptoms of sacroiliac joint dysfunction include lower back pain, stiffness, and instability.

Shoulder pain is one of the most common injuries we treat at the practice. One of the most common causes of this pain is "pinching" of the shoulder muscles.

Shoulder pain - could it be your rotator cuff? The shoulder joint is made up of the ball (humeral head) and the socket (glenoid). Low back pain: The Intervertebral disc

A disc is a structure between your vertebrae, made up of a soft inner and tough outer part and consists mostly of water.
It has the following functions:
📍Acts as a shock absorber
📍Keeps the distance between your vertebrae during movement
📍Maintains the curve of your back
📍Provides flexibility to your spine.

When overloaded or damaged, it can press against the nerves close to it and cause pain - either at the site of pressure or referred (felt elsewhere).

Fortunately, this is a condition that usually responds very well to physiotherapy, depending on the severity 🙂

Low back pain: What puts you at risk?

📍Being overweight
📍A desk job or job involving heavy lifting and/or twisting
📍Psychological factors
📍Genetics
📍Smoking
*Overloaded backpacks - children

Low back pain is one of the most common conditions we treat at the practice. We'll give you some more info on it in our upcoming posts.

What causes Low Back Pain?
There are various causes, including but not limited to:

📍Nerve and spinal cord problems e.g nerve compression
📍Degeneration e.g worn out discs, arthritis
📍Injuries e.g sprains, strains, accidents
📍Congenital (present from birth) e.g spina bifida, scoliosis
📍Non-spinal causes e.g endometriosis, kidney stones

(Source: U.S. Department of Health and Human Services, National Institutes of Health)
